**Ticket: Invoice PDFs render with overlapping line items on long orders**

The Quillbeam PDF renderer chokes when an invoice has more than 40 line items — rows start stacking on top of the footer instead of paginating. Looks like the page-break logic in the layout pass never accounts for the variable-height discount rows that Marla's team added last quarter. Temporary workaround: cap items per page at 30. Future maintainers, please don't "fix" this by shrinking the font again. The regression first appeared in this build.

session token of tajef-bageg = htk21_5d90d574934f3ccae6437

- [ ] **Step 7: Breaker override escrow.** After sealing the signing keys for the Tallgrove upstream API circuit breaker, confirm the support team can force the breaker open during a full outage. The override bundle lives in the sealed escrow drawer and is useless without its unlock phrase. Two ceremony witnesses must initial this step before proceeding. The escrow bundle is decrypted with the recovery passphrase that follows.

vault phrase of kahip-kahop = holath-quenmir

## Configuration

Heads up, reviewer: Quillden's role-based access is all driven from the .env. Set WIKI_ROLES=admin,editor,viewer and WIKI_DEFAULT_ROLE=viewer so anonymous users can't edit. Role claims come signed from the auth sidecar, and it needs a shared secret to verify them — put that on the next line:

secret setting of yajog-taguf: ARCHIVE_KEY3=051

TURN-208: Gatevale turnstile counters at the Merrow Field pilot double-count when a rotation reverses mid-cycle. Attendance totals drift roughly 2% high per event. The debounce window fix is implemented, reviewed by Ilsa, and soak-tested across two simulated match days without drift. Ready for your cut; the candidate build is identified below.

trace token, tagag-tafog: htk6_5ed18c